Davis Ally to Lead Va. 'Victory 08' Campaign

Tim Craig

The Republican National Committee announced today that Nicholas Meads will be the director of the party's coordinated campaign in Virginia this year.

Meads, who served as Rep. Tom Davis's 2006 campaign manager, has been active in Virginia GOP political campaigns since 2003, when he graduated from the College of William and Mary. After graduation, Meads managed David Kennedy's unsuccessful campaign to become a state delegate, representing Alexandria. The following year, Meads began working for Davis, serving as his deputy campaign manager. Through his work for Davis, Meads was also involved in former state Sen. Jeannemarie Devolites Davis's reelection effort in 2007.

Experience on Meads resume also includes serving as former attorney general Jerry W. Kilgore's (R) Fairfax County field director during his unsuccessful bid for governor and work for Supervisor Michael C. May (R-Occoquan).

As director of Virginia's Victory 08 program, Meads will help coordinate Republican resources on behalf of Arizona Sen. John McCain, the presumptive GOP nominee for president. In addition, he will assist the reelection efforts of seven incumbent Republican members of Congress. This work will include, helping to retain Tom Davis's seat in the 11th District.

Davis is retiring, giving Democrats a prime opportunity to pick up a seat in increasingly Democratic Northern Virginia. Republicans will also be fighting to retain the seat of retiring U.S. Sen. John W. Warner's (R-Va).

"As election day draws closer and we continue to grow the Republican National Committee's presence across the country, I feel confident Americans will embrace John McCain and Republican candidates up and down the ballot on Election Day because of the hard work and positive message we are spreading to voters," Mike Duncan, chairman of the Republican National Committee, said in a statement announcing Mead's appointment.
